Nuh to Ajmer

Updated: 21 May 2026

The journey from Nuh to Ajmer covers about 350 km. You can reach Ajmer by taking a train from Delhi or driving via the NH 48. Ajmer is a major city in Rajasthan, known for the Ajmer Sharif Dargah. The route passes through the scenic landscapes of Rajasthan.

Total Distance: 350 km by road, 300 km air distance.
Fastest Way
Train from Delhi to Ajmer takes 6 hours.
Cheapest Way
Sleeper class train from Delhi to Ajmer costs around 250 INR.

Things to Do in Ajmer
1
Ajmer Sharif Dargah
Visit this famous Sufi shrine, a place of peace and devotion.
2
Ana Sagar Lake
Relax in this beautiful lake with a garden on its banks.
3
Adhai Din Ka Jhonpra
See this historic mosque, a masterpiece of Indo-Islamic architecture.
4
Taragarh Fort
Visit this historic fort on a hill, offering a great view of the city.
